Bushi,
yeah, i bgt them all. Difficult to answer as some of the footage actually DOES have the 2 clowns commentating<img src=icon_smile_clown.gif border=0 align=middle><img src=icon_smile_wink.gif border=0 align=middle> but it does not appear to be the Fox footage.
The boys told me it was the Japanese release footage, not sure if it was some Fox and some independent filming, but generally quality is fair to good.
Don't worry there is no Japanese chatter. You can hear the crowd noise, music, ring announcer etc, and occasionally the boys commentating.
I'd rate it as VCR quality footage. I guess the main thing is that some fantastic fights are there which you will not get to see again or keep on a lasting file media (ie DVD). I bought a heap of the Dvd's from Roy and Ray as well and agree with Voice. They are not as slick as Foxtel and generally just one Camera but there is some great fights and fights that weren't shown on Foxtel. Actually I am just watching the TS2 Chris White fight from Xplosion 8 as I type.
All in all they are pretty good value. I also have the Knees of Fury 6 dvd which you can buy from Sportzblitz. While the footage and is sharper and it includes the foxtel commentary The over alll production (dvd authoring, Chapters etc) is much better on the rising dvds.
